Four Virginia artists Wilma Bradner, of Richmond, Elaine Hurst, of Port Republic, Debby Thomas, of Moseley, and Kristin Waters Wise, of Greenville founded the Virginia Equine Artists Association (VEAA) in 2005 in order to promote and market Virginia equine art and to provide educational opportunities for Virginia equine artists and photographers.
Today we are a thriving artists association with over 35 members.
